TaxTips.ca - BC PST - Verification of a Purchaser

WebNov 16, 2024 · The buyer must provide the seller with their BC PST number or complete an exemption certificate for the PST to not be charged on the sale. If a BC PST number is not provided or an exemption certificate is not completed, then PST will be charged on the taxable goods even if they will be resold. WebThe BC Government website says, "The PST Number Verification Service is a free and optional service that you [businesses] can use to verify the PST number of your customers. You [businesses] are not required to verify the PST numbers of each of your customers …

The GST is a federal sales tax of five percent that’s imposed on most goods and services sold and purchased across Canada. Certain retail, real estate and personal services have the tax attached. This tax was first imposed in January 1991 to replace a 13.5 percent tax, known as the manufacturer’s sales tax, that was … hillcrest nursing home coloradoWebOnly four Canadian provinces have PST (Provincial Sales Tax): British Columbia, Manitoba, Québec and Saskatchewan.In Québec it is called QST (Québec Sales Tax) and in Manitoba it is RST (Retail Sales Tax).. In New Brunswick, Newfoundland and Labrador, Nova Scotia, Ontario and Prince Edward Island it is part of HST (Harmonized Sales Tax).
